首页正文

后段开发岗位未来就业前景如何

作者:王子赫 人气:45

一、后段开发岗位未来就业前景如何

后段开发岗位未来的就业前景具有一定的积极因素,同时也面临一些挑战和变化,主要体现在以下几个方面:

积极方面:

1. 持续的技术需求:随着数字化和信息化的不断推进,各种应用和系统需要强大稳定的后端支持,对后段开发人才的需求将长期存在。

2. 数据驱动的发展:大量数据的处理和管理依赖后端技术,在后段开发中涉及数据存储、处理、分析等方面的技能将越来越重要。

3. 云技术的广泛应用:云原生开发等相关领域的发展,为后段开发岗位提供了新的机会和拓展空间。

挑战方面:

1. 技术更新快:需要不断学习和适应新的技术框架和工具,以保持竞争力。

2. 竞争加剧:由于技术门槛相对较高,吸引了众多人才涌入,竞争压力可能会逐渐增大。

3. 融合趋势:前后端界限可能逐渐模糊,对后段开发人员的综合能力要求更高,需要具备更广泛的知识和技能。

总体而言,后段开发岗位仍有较好的就业前景,但个人需要保持学习和提升,以应对不断变化的市场需求和技术发展。

二、前段开发和后段开发哪个好些

前端开发和后端开发都有各自的特点和优势,不能简单地说哪个更好,它们在软件开发中都起着重要的作用,以下是对它们的一些比较:

前端开发的优点:

1. 直接与用户交互:能塑造直观的用户体验,看到自己的成果对用户产生即时影响,有较强的成就感。

2. 视觉和创意性:涉及界面设计、布局等,对于有设计感和创意追求的人有吸引力。

3. 快速反馈:开发过程中能较快看到效果,便于调试和改进。

前端开发的缺点:

1. 受浏览器兼容性等问题影响较大。

2. 技术更新较快,需要不断学习跟进。

后端开发的优点:

1. 逻辑和架构:专注于系统的逻辑、数据处理和性能优化,对逻辑思维能力要求较高,有挑战性。

2. 稳定性和安全性:保障整个系统的稳定运行和数据安全。

3. 广泛适用性:后端技术在不同类型的项目中都非常关键。

后端开发的缺点:

1. 工作成果相对不那么直观,用户较难直接感知。

2. 可能涉及复杂的算法和架构设计,学习曲线相对较陡。

选择前端还是后端开发,主要取决于个人的兴趣、技能偏好以及职业规划。有些人喜欢与界面打交道,注重用户体验;而另一些人则对系统逻辑和数据处理更感兴趣。无论选择哪个方向,只要不断学习和提升,都能取得良好的发展。

三、开发前段容易还是后端容易

开发前端和后端哪个更容易不能简单地一概而论,因为它们都有各自的特点和挑战。

前端开发通常更注重用户界面和交互设计,需要掌握 HTML、CSS、JavaScript 等技术,以及各种前端框架和库。对于有较好设计感和对用户体验较为敏感的人来说,可能会觉得前端开发相对容易上手一些,能够较快看到直观的成果。

后端开发则主要涉及数据处理、业务逻辑、服务器配置等方面,需要掌握如 Python、Java、Node.js 等编程语言以及相关的数据库知识、服务器管理等。后端开发可能需要更深入的编程逻辑思维和对系统架构的理解。

随着技术的发展和项目的复杂性增加,前端和后端都有各自的难度和深度,都需要不断学习和提升技能。而且在实际项目中,前后端紧密协作,要成为一名优秀的全栈开发者,需要对前后端都有深入的理解和掌握。最终哪个更容易还是因人而异,取决于个人的兴趣、基础和学习能力。

四、开发前段与后端的区别

前端开发和后端开发主要有以下一些区别:

前端开发:

1. 用户界面:主要关注与用户直接交互的界面部分,包括页面布局、视觉设计、交互效果等。

2. 技术栈:通常涉及 HTML、CSS、JavaScript 等,以及各种前端框架和库。

3. 用户体验:着重于提供流畅、直观、美观的用户体验。

4. 运行环境:在用户的浏览器中运行。

5. 数据展示:负责将后端传来的数据以合适的形式展示给用户。

后端开发:

1. 业务逻辑:处理数据、实现业务规则、管理系统的功能和流程。

2. 技术栈:如 Java、Python、Node.js、数据库等。

3. 数据处理:与数据库交互,进行数据存储、检索、更新等操作。

4. 服务器端:运行在服务器上,为前端提供数据和服务支持。

5. 安全性和稳定性:更关注系统的安全性、性能优化和稳定运行。